The Rise of AI Chatbots: A Threat to Traditional Online Businesses

The emergence of AI chatbots like ChatGPT is reshaping the landscape of online search, posing a significant challenge to established giants like Google. As these intelligent systems become more sophisticated, they are changing how users interact with information on the internet. Instead of sifting through pages of search results, consumers can now engage in conversational queries, receiving direct answers tailored to their needs. This shift in user behavior could lead to a decline in traffic for traditional websites, threatening the revenue streams of countless online businesses reliant on search engine visibility.
